Location: Caesarea and Tel Aviv-Yafo
Job Type: Full Time and Hybrid work
Physical Design team within us is responsible for the entire backend methodology and flow development from RTL to GDS. This is a critical part of the group leading the development of high-quality VLSI designs.

We demonstrate the latest silicon technologies and processes to build the largest-scale and most complex devices, pushing the boundaries of feasibility.

Your Impact
You'll be part of the team, which is at the heart of our software and ASIC design efforts.

You'll handle all aspects of chip design, including Definition, Physical Synthesis, Place and Route, Optimization, Timing Closure, Design Floor Planning.
Requirements:
Minimum Requirements:
A VLSI Design with extensive experience in backend design.
B.Sc./M.Sc. in Electrical Engineering.
Strong understanding of Place & Route flow.
7+ years of hands-on experience in a relevant domain

Preferred/Advantageous Qualifications:
Deep understanding of all aspects of Physical construction and Integration.
Knowledge in Physical Design Verification methodology LVS/DRC.
Familiarity with physical design EDA tools (such as Synopsys, Cadence, etc.).
Great teammate, self-learning skills, and ability to work autonomously.
This position is open to all candidates.

Location: Tel Aviv-Yafo
Job Type: Full Time
We are looking for best-in-class Physical Design Engineers to join our outstanding Networking Silicon engineering team, developing the industry's best high-speed communication devices, delivering the highest throughput and lowest latency! Come and take a part in designing our groundbreaking and innovating chips, enjoy working in a meaningful, growing and highly professional environment where you make a significant impact in a technology-focused company.

What you'll be doing:

Physical design of blocks according to specifications under challenging constraints targeting for the best power, area, and performance.

Be exposed and work on a variety of challenging designs (including high cell count and HS blocks). Resolving complex timing and congestion problems.

Daily work involves all aspects of physical design chip development (RTL2GDS) - synthesis, power and clock distribution, place and route, timing closure, power and noise analysis, and physical verification.

Taking part inflows development.
Requirements:
B.SC./ M.SC. in Electrical Engineering/Computer Engineering or equivalent work experience.

3+ years of experience in physical design.

Proven experience in RTL2GDS flows and methodologies.

Knowledge in physical design flows and methodologies (PNR, STA, physical verification).

Deep understanding of all aspects of Physical construction and Integration.

Knowledge in Physical Design Verification methodology LVS/DRC.

Familiarity with physical design EDA tools (such as Synopsys, Cadence, etc.).

Great teammate.
This position is open to all candidates.

Location: Tel Aviv-Yafo and Yokne`am
Job Type: Full Time
We are looking for best-in-class Physical Design Power Engineer to join our outstanding Networking Silicon Power engineering team, developing the industry's best high-speed communication devices, delivering the highest throughput, lowest latency and best Power! Come and take a part in designing our groundbreaking and innovating chips, enjoy working in a meaningful, growing and highly professional environment where you make a significant impact in a technology-focused company.

What you will be doing:

Power Optimization of Physical design, of blocks/top-level/fc under challenging constraints.

Optimization involves all aspects of physical design chip development (RTL2GDS) - synthesis, power and clock distribution, place and route, timing closure, power and noise fixes.

Power estimation and power modeling.
Requirements:
B.SC./ M.SC. or equivalent experience in Electrical Engineering/Computer Engineering.

2+ years of experience in physical design and/or BE power optimization aspects.

Familiarity with physical design EDA tools (such as Synopsys, Cadence, etc.).

Knowledge in physical design flows and methodologies (PNR, STA, physical verification) is an advantage.

FE design experience is an advantage.

Excellent problem-solving, partnership, and interpersonal skills.
This position is open to all candidates.

Location: Tel Aviv-Yafo and Haifa
Job Type: Full Time
Be part of a team that pushes boundaries, developing custom silicon solutions that power the future of our company's direct-to-consumer products. You'll contribute to the innovation behind products loved by millions worldwide. Your expertise will shape the next generation of hardware experiences, delivering unparalleled performance, efficiency, and integration.
As part of our Server Chip Design team, you will use your ASIC design experience to be part of a team that creates the SoC VLSI design cycle from start to finish. You will collaborate closely with design and verification engineers in active projects, creating architecture definitions with RTL coding, and running block level simulations.
As a Design & Power Methodology Team Manager within the Server Chip Design team, you will be responsible of managing and leading design and power methodologies from IP to SoC, pre and post silicon. You will be responsible for mentoring and developing team members and tech leads while driving improvements in leadership, technical execution, and design flows.
You will work closely with CAD vendors and internal teams to develop lead design and power methodology and execution.
The AI and Infrastructure team is redefining whats possible. We empower our company customers with breakthrough capabilities and insights by delivering AI and Infrastructure at unparalleled scale, efficiency, reliability and velocity. Our customers, our company Cloud customers, and billions of our company users worldwide.
We're the driving force behind our company's groundbreaking innovations, empowering the development of our cutting-edge AI models, delivering unparalleled computing power to global services, and providing the essential platforms that enable developers to build the future. From software to hardware our teams are shaping the future of world-leading hyperscale computing, with key teams working on the development of our TPUs, Vertex AI for our company Cloud, our company Global Networking, Data Center operations, systems research, and much more.
Responsibilities
Manage a team of tech leads and designers. Develop and mentor team members, and communicate and co-work with multi-disciplined and multi-site teams.
Lead flow and methodology development and assimilation across multiple groups. Work closely with CAD tool providers as well as internal CAD teams.
Plan, execute, track progress, assure quality, and report status.
Work closely with internal customers and support multiple activities and deliverables.
Drive design methodologies such as design construction, CDC, RDC, SDC. Drive power at: IP and SoC RTL/Gate Level Optimization, estimation, correlation.
Requirements:
Minimum qualifications:
Bachelor's degree in Electrical Engineering, Computer Engineering, Computer Science, a related field, or equivalent practical experience.
10 years of experience in RTL Design cycle IP and SoC.
8 years of experience in team management.
Experience with design methodologies, structural checks, and power estimation/optimization.
Preferred qualifications:
Experience with synthesis techniques to optimize Register-Transfer Level (RTL) code, performance and power as well as low-power design techniques.
Experience with a scripting language like Python or Perl.
Experience with design for test and its impact on design and physical design.
Knowledge of IP and SOC architecture.
Knowledge of physical design techniques: SDC, Synthesis, EMIR, etc.
This position is open to all candidates.

Location: Tel Aviv-Yafo
Job Type: Full Time
We are looking for a Senior ASIC Physical Design Engineer to join our dynamic team, Join the ride as we spearhead the next revolution in electronics!
What Youll Do
Own and continuously improve our smooth product backend integration methodology, flows, and best practices using Cadence and Synopsys tools.
Develop, maintain, and scale automation and infrastructure (TCL / Python) to improve quality, predictability, and turnaround time.
Collaborate closely with multiple teams to ensure smooth handoffs and high-quality product.
Support field teams on complex technical issues when needed.
Responsibilities
Implementation of ASIC units using advanced flows
Developing BackEnd methodology using Cadence and Synopsys tools
Build and develop scripts for physical design implementation
Support Field team with customer issues.
Requirements:
8+ years of hands-on experience with ASIC physical design (RTL-to-GDS).
Proven experience taking multiple full-chip SoCs from RTL through tapeout.
Deep knowledge of Cadence and/or Synopsys backend flows (experience with both is a strong plus).
Strong understanding of PnR, timing closure, SI, power, DRC/LVS, and signoff.
Excellent debugging and problem-solving skills.
Strong scripting skills in TCL and Python.
Nice-to-have / Advantage
Experience with multiple power domains and low-power design techniques.
Background that spans both frontend (RTL) and backend.
Experience influencing or defining methodology across teams or projects.
Personal skills
Innovation, quick learning abilities
Team player
Commitment, full ownership of tasks
Excellent communication and presentation skills
Customer orientation
A strong sense of ownership.
This position is open to all candidates.
